SHEER GENIUS

Hyke is one of those brands that if you know, you know. The Japanese outfit, founded by husband-and-wife duo Hideaki Yoshihara and Yukiko Ode, has been working on its own interpretation of contemporary, minimally designed fashion since 2013. While Hyke does categorically women’s fashion, its design aesthetics—marked by clean lines, utilitarian elements, and at times, oversized volumes—lend a genderless appeal that has gained a cult following among the stylish men and women in Japan and abroad.

It helps too that the brand has had successful collaborations with the likes of adidas and The North Face. Not only have these further spread Hyke’s awareness in among the streetwear-leaning set, but also cemented its position as one of Japan’s rising stars in fashion.

Moncler Genius is by far Hyke’s biggest project yet. The scale was magnified even more with a renewed approach to the new edition that Moncler dubbed Mondogenius, a live virtual event spanning across several countries during Milan Fashion Week
